  • Combine harvester MASSEY FERGUSON MF 30 – 31 MF-30 and MF-31 were small-sized harvest combines that were very popular on European market in 60s. MF-30 header width was 175 cm and MF-31 was 210 cm. The speed on these machines was regulated smoothly using mechanically controlled variator. The hopper capacity on MF-30 model was 6,5 ton and 10 ton on MF-31...

    Combine harvester MASSEY FERGUSON MF 330 – 430 In 1982  MF-330 и MF-430 harvest combines were presented. They were aimed at satisfaction of small farms requirements. Four-cylinder diesel Perkins engines with a power of 75 h.p. and 85 h.p. set in the motion respectively MF-330 and MF-430. Harvesters were completed with headers which width of capture...

    Combine harvester MASSEY FERGUSON MF 410 – 515 In 1965 MF-510 combine, the successor of MF-500 model, was introduced. The Perkins engine with 104 hp capacity was assembled on this model. In the same year MF-410 combines were introduced into production that replaced MF-400. This combines were also assembled with Perkins engine with 95 h.p. capacity....
